There's nothing anywhere that says it's a Sentient. That was just Moreco's theory crafting at work. However, there's nothing "official" stating it to be a Dragon's pelt (afaik) other than it being called the "Dragon Frame" by the Devs, being inspired by a fan's Dragon concept frame (it literally used one his concept's powers), being based on the Chromatic dragons from D&D, & having a helmet called Drac helmet (alluding to the word draconian; a name commonly used for reptile/dragon races in many games, shows, etc).

 

So, think what you will.

It's not really "stated" but moreso made by observation on my part

 

Compare 

 

warframe.jpg?bd7a53

 

and

 

ChromaSplash.jpg

 

In particular, note the thick upper thighs of the Sentient compared to the thighs on the Chroma's pelt and the little wing things that come out of the back of each - square-shaped, though Chroma's are smaller.

 

The sort of tuning-fork shape of the Sentient's weapons even matches with the two-fingers of the Chroma pelt while he has it deployed.

 

 

It's just speculation on my part, but I'm thinking that it's very well-founded speculation - ESPECIALLY given that a Chroma was apparently being Sentient-controlled during The New Strange. How could they manage this? I mean, they can't control our Warframes, that's one of the reasons we were so effective against them...

 

Well, if Chroma was wearing one of their own machines as a suit, then all they would have to do is be able to interface with the Sentient body and they could puppet the Warframe underneath all they wanted.
